Raise a glass - Glider across the Atlantic! 65 years ago by Dave Newill
This weekend at your club or operations - raise a glass to those intreped souls who flew a mission called Voodoo 65 years ago. (copied from Fiddlers green website) On June 23, 1943, a CG-4A nicknamed "Voodoo" (RAF serial number FR579) took off from RCAF Dorval and set course to Goose...

Cloud Flying by Shawn Knickerbocker
Brain... It does not...nowhere in the FAR. But, you must have the following rating to fly IFR/IMC in a sailplane: PVT or higher airplane Instrument rating Airplane, either ASE or AME or ATP Airplane, again ASE or AME
